Tavion Thomas (born May 22, 2000) is an American football running back who played for the Utah Utes.

High school career

Thomas attended Dunbar High School in Dayton, Ohio. As a senior he rushed for 1,663 yards with 24 touchdowns. He committed to the University of Cincinnati to play college football. [1]

College career

Thomas played 2018 and 2019 at Cincinnati. In his two years he rushed for 689 yards on 129 carries with seven touchdowns. [2] In 2020 he transferred to Independence Community College. He rushed for 347 yards with five touchdowns in his lone season at Independence. [3] In 2021, Thomas transferred to the University of Utah. [4] [5] He started four of 13 games his first year at Utah, leading the team with 1,108 yards on 204 carries with a school record 21 touchdowns. [6] Thomas returned to Utah for 2022 rather than enter the 2022 NFL Draft. [7] He played in only 10 games, including 2 in a limited role, and totaled 730 all-purpose yards and 7 touchdowns.

Personal life

While preparing for the 2023 NFL Draft, Thomas was arrested and charged with three felonies related to alleged domestic violence against his girlfriend. [8] Thomas is also facing domestic abuse charges in a separate incident involving a different woman. [9]

After going undrafted by the NFL, Thomas was listed by a scout as being on the XFL watch list, but was not signed in 2023. [12]
